Understanding Staples Phone Trade-In Program
Staples offers a convenient trade-in program that allows customers to exchange their used smartphones for store credit or cash. The program supports a wide range of devices, including popular brands like Apple, Samsung, and Google. The amount you receive depends on the device’s model, condition, and current market value.
Steps to Get the Best Trade-In Rates
- Research Your Device’s Value: Use online tools like Gazelle, Decluttr, or Swappa to get an idea of your phone’s worth before heading to Staples.
- Assess Your Phone’s Condition: Be honest about scratches, cracks, battery life, and functionality. Devices in better condition fetch higher offers.
- Backup and Erase Your Data: Ensure all personal information is securely backed up and then perform a factory reset to protect your privacy.
- Gather Accessories and Original Packaging: Including original chargers, cables, and boxes can sometimes increase your trade-in value.
- Compare Offers: Check if Staples’ trade-in offer matches or exceeds online buyback prices. Don’t hesitate to shop around.
Maximizing Your Trade-In Value
There are additional tips to ensure you get the most out of your trade-in:
- Keep Your Device Updated: Software updates can improve performance and may influence trade-in offers.
- Remove Personal Accounts: Sign out of iCloud, Google, and other accounts to prevent activation lock issues.
- Clean Your Device: A clean phone looks better and may slightly influence the appraisal.
- Trade-In During Promotions: Look for special deals or bonus offers at Staples, especially during holiday seasons or back-to-school periods.
